What is Cosmetology

Oskaloosa KS makeup school studentCosmetology is a profession that is all about making the human anatomy look more beautiful with the application of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are regarded as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the term c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ic can be anything that improves the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, the majority of states mandate that you undergo some type of specialized training and then become licensed. Once you are licensed, the work settings include not only Oskaloosa KS beauty salons and barber shops, but also such businesses as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have gained experience and a client base, establish their own shops or salons. Others will start seeing customers either in their own homes or will go to the client’s home, or both. Cosmetology college graduates go by many professional names and work in a wide range of specializations including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As previously stated, in the majority of states working cosmetologists have to be licensed. In some states there is an exemption. Only those offering more skilled services, such as h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Other people employed in cosmetology and less skilled, such as shampooers, are not required to be lic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ees and Certificates

Oskaloosa KS hair design student cutting hairThere are essentially two avenues offered to obtain cosmetology training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s generally call for 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are available if you wish to concentrate on just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also probably feature management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to run a parlor or other Oskaloosa KS business. More advanced deg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whichever type of program you choose, it’s important to make certain that it’s approved by the Kansas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only certify schools that are accredited by certain highly regarded agencies,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Cosmetologist Classes

Oskaloosa KS student attending online beauty schoolOnline beauty classes are accommodating for Oskaloosa KS students who are working full-time and have family commitments that make it difficult to enroll in a more traditional school. There are numerous online beauty school programs offered that can be attended through a personal comput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ional beauty programs are often fast paced since many courses are as short as 6 or 8 months. This means that a significant amount of time is spent in the classroom. With internet programs, you are covering the same volume of material, but you are not spending numerous hours away from your home or commuting to and from classes. However, it’s imperative that the school you select can provide internship training in local salons and parlors to ensure that you also receive the hands-on training needed for a complete education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s impossible to gain the skills required to work in any area of the cosmetology profession. So make sure if you choose to enroll in an online school to verify that internship training is available in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s essential to make sure that the cosmetology school you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ards ensu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for getting student loans or financial aid, which often are not offered in 66066 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, many Oskaloosa KS businesses will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more positively upon those with accredited training.

Does the School have a Good Reputation?  Every cosmetologist college that you are seriously considering should have a good to excellent reputation within the profession. Being accredited is a good beginning. Next, ask the schools for references from their network of businesses where they have placed their students. Verify that the schools have high job placement rates, showing that their students are highly regarded. Visit rating companies for reviews along with the school’s accrediting agencies. If you have any relationships with Oskaloosa KS salon owners or managers, or any person working in the industry, ask them if they are familiar with the schools you are reviewing. They might even be able to propose others that you had not considered. Finally, check with the Kansas school licensing authority to find out if there have been any grievances submitted or if the schools are in full compliance.

What’s the School’s Focus?  A number of cosmetology schools offer programs that are expansive in nature, concentrating on all facets of cosmetology. Others are more focused, offering training in a specific specialty, for instance hairstyling, manicuring or electrolysis. Schools that offer degree programs typically expand into a management and marketing curriculum. So it’s essential that you choose a school that focuses on your area of interest. If your ambition is to be trained as an esthetician, make certain that the school you enroll in is accredited and respected for that program. If your dream is to open a hair salon in Oskaloosa KS, then you need to enroll in a degree program that will teach you how to be an owner/operator. Selecting a highly rated school with a poor program in the specialty you are pursuing will not provide the training you need.

Is Any Live Training Provided?  Studying and perfecting cosmetology techniques and abilities requires plenty of practice on people. Ask how much live, hands-on training is included in the cosmetology classes you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on campus that make it possible for students to practice their developing talents on volunteers. If a beauty program provides little or no scheduled live training, but instead depends heavily on utilizing mannequins, it might not be the most effective alternative for developing your skills. Therefore look for alternate schools that provide this type of training.

Does the School Provide Job Assistance?  Once a student graduates from a cosmetology school, it’s crucial that he or she receives aid in landing that initial job. Job placement programs are an important part of that process. Schools that furnish assistance maintain relationships with Oskaloosa KS businesses that are searching for trained graduates available for hiring. Confirm that the programs you are looking at have job placement programs and ask which salons and organizations they refer students to. Additionally, find out what their job placement rates are. Higher rates not only affirm that they have wide networks of employers, but that their programs are highly respected as well.

Is Financial Aid Offered?  The majority of cosmetology schools offer financ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Ask if the schools you are investigating have a financial aid office. Speak with a counselor and find out what student loans or grants you may qualify for. If the school is a member of the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ships offered to students as well. If a school satisfies all of your other qualifications except for expense, do not omit it as an alternative until you find out what financial assistance may be offered.

    Oskaloosa, Kansas

    Oskaloosa is located at 39°12′57″N 95°18′50″W / 39.21583°N 95.31389°W / 39.21583; -95.31389 (39.215849, -95.313800).[13] It is at the intersection of U.S. Route 59 and K-92, approximately 15 miles north of Lawrence. According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 1.03 square miles (2.67 km2), of which, 1.02 square miles (2.64 km2) is land and 0.01 square miles (0.03 km2) is water.[1]

    The climate in this area is characterized by hot, humid summers and generally mild to cool winters. According to the Köppen Climate Classification system, Oskaloosa has a humid subtropical climate, abbreviated "Cfa" on climate maps.[14]

    As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 1,113 people, 435 households, and 281 families residing in the city. The population density was 1,091.2 inhabitants per square mile (421.3/km2). There were 480 housing units at an average density of 470.6 per square mile (181.7/km2). The racial makeup of the city was 97.0% White, 0.2% African American, 0.8% Native American, 0.3% Asian, 0.1% from other races, and 1.6%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 0.9% of the population.
